Matt Mullenweg on Automattic’s Future: A Personal Approach to Succession Planning

In the dynamic world of technology, succession planning can often be a contentious topic. Automattic, the company behind WordPress.com, WooCommerce, and Tumblr, recently made headlines when its CEO, Matt Mullenweg, candidly shared his views on succession. More than just a routine corporate announcement, Mullenweg’s approach emphasizes a very personal touch to leadership transition. He has expressed, "I don’t want to pass it to a committee," highlighting his desire for a thoughtful and cohesive handover process that aligns with the community-driven spirit of Automattic.

Understanding the Automattic Philosophy

Founded in 2005, Automattic has grown into a powerhouse of open-source web tools. Its success is deeply intertwined with Mullenweg’s values, which emphasize openness, transparency, and strong community connections. These principles not only guide the company’s corporate governance but also its approach to leadership transitions.

A Community-Driven Organization

Automattic stands out for its commitment to the open-source ecosystem. Under Mullenweg’s leadership, the company has championed:

  • Open-source software development
  • Distributed workforce models
  • Community initiatives that empower individual contributors

The community-driven approach is pivotal in understanding why Mullenweg places such importance on personal succession planning, focusing on individual relationships rather than bureaucratic processes.

Matt Mullenweg’s Personal Approach

Mullenweg’s choice to personally oversee the succession process rather than leave it to a committee reflects his deep commitment to Automattic’s future. His approach is based on several key principles:

Personal Relationships Trump Bureaucracy

A Committee’s Disadvantages:

  • Committees can dilute responsibility and accountability.
  • They might not fully appreciate the unique culture and dynamics of Automattic.
Benefits of a Personal Approach
  • Strong Personal Connection: Mullenweg believes in fostering strong personal relationships which can facilitate a smoother, more organic transition.
  • Direct Mentorship: By directly mentoring potential successors, he can ensure they embody the company’s core values and vision.
  • Tailored Transition: Allows for a customized approach to transition, responsive to specific needs and circumstances at Automattic.
